E-learning Module for Confidential Advisors in Prevention – Quarter 3

The module contains information, reflection questions, and several measurement moments to gather insights and sentiment. The modules can be shared via a platform, internal newsletter, or e-learning tool.

What Works for Us?

Objective: To identify, strengthen, and highlight the positive elements of social safety.

Introduction: Social safety is not only about what goes wrong. It’s also about what goes well. Where is listening happening? Where are mistakes allowed? What makes you feel welcome?

Content:

  • Examples of positive behavior: genuine check-ins, open agendas, space for vulnerability.
  • Stories from practice: small moments that make a big difference.

Reflection Questions:

  • Who makes a difference for you in the workplace, and why?

  • Which habits in your team contribute to safety?

Mini-poll:

  • “In my team, caring for each other is taken for granted.”
  • Open question: “What would you like to see more often in your department?”

Closing: By strengthening what works, we actively build a culture where people dare to speak up and thrive.
